Unleash Your Future: Choosing the Right University Major
Wiki Article
Choosing a university major is a crucial decision that can direct your future career path and overall life course. It's important to carefully consider your hobbies, skills, and long-term goals when making this significant choice.
- Investigate different majors and career paths that resonate with your strengths and motivations.
- Talk to practitioners in diverse fields to understand perspectives about their work and the skills demanded.
- Assess your academic approach and opt for a major that matches it well.
Remember, your university major is not always set in stone. Many students change majors over time as they uncover their true vocations.
Embark the Maze: A Guide to University Course Selection
University life can be thrilling and daunting all at once. One of the most daunting aspects for new students is navigating the vast sea of available courses. With so many choices to examine, it's easy to feel overwhelmed. But fear not! This guide will equip you with the tools and knowledge to choose your courses strategically, ensuring a rewarding and meaningful academic journey.
- Kick off by identifying your interests and goals. What subjects truly fascinate you?
- Explore the university's course catalog thoroughly. Read descriptions, preview syllabi, and learn about faculty members.
- Consult academic advisors. They can provide personalized recommendations based on your individual needs and aspirations.
Remember, course selection is a evolving process. Be open to trying new things, exploring hidden passions, and adapting your plan as you go.
